Effectiveness of BenZalkonium Chloride Gel as Vaginal Contraceptive: a Multicentric Randomized Controlled Trial
Phase 2
Completed
240 enrolled
Shanghai Institute of Planned Parenthood Research
Chang Jiang Bio-pharmaceutical Co., Ltd. · collabFudan University · collabInternational Peace Maternity and Child Health Hospital · collabShanghai Municipal Commission of Health and Family Planning · collabShanghai No. 1 Maternity and Child Care Center · collab
RandomizedParallel-groupDouble-blindPrevention
Summary
A multicentric clinical trial in three Chinese Maternal and Child Hospitals was conducted to evaluate the efficacy, safety and acceptability of newly-developed vaginal contraceptive gel, the optimized benzalkonium chloride (BZK) gel containing 18mg BZK, with comparison to a currently marketed (in China)contraceptive gel LELEMI® containing 50mg Nonoxynol-9 (N-9).
